Your 5-Step Blueprint to Audio Passive Income

Step 1: Find Your Sonic Micro-Niche

The biggest mistake you can make is being too generic. Don’t just create “rain sounds.” Nobody is looking for that because there are already a million versions. Instead, go for the micro-niche. Think “Rain hitting a corrugated tin roof in a tropical jungle” or “The low hum of a starship engine room with occasional computer chirps.” These specific keywords are what desperate, distracted workers are actually typing into search bars. Use tools like Google Trends or YouTube search auto-complete to find these gaps.

Step 2: Generate High-Fidelity Audio with AI

You don’t need a microphone. Use advanced AI audio platforms like Udio or Suno to generate base layers of specific textures. For example, you can prompt an AI to create a 2-minute high-quality loop of “analog modular synth drones for focus.” However, the secret sauce is layering. Take that AI base and layer it with free, commercially-licensed field recordings from sites like Freesound.org. This creates a unique, complex sound that can’t be easily replicated by others.

Step 3: Mastering the Perfect “Infinite Loop”

In the world of ambient audio, a “pop” or a “click” at the end of a track is a dealbreaker. It breaks the listener’s flow. You’ll want to use Audacity (which is free) to create a crossfade loop. This involves taking the end of your audio track and overlapping it with the beginning, creating a seamless transition that can run for 10 hours without the listener ever noticing the reset point. This technical polish is what separates the $3,000/month creators from the amateurs.

Step 4: Multi-Channel Distribution Strategy

Don’t just put your sounds on one platform. You need to be everywhere. First, upload to stock audio sites like AudioJungle and Pond5 where filmmakers and app developers buy licenses. Second, create 10-hour versions for YouTube to capture ad revenue. Third, use a distributor like DistroKid to get your “albums” of focus sounds onto Spotify and Apple Music. This triple-threat approach ensures that one single piece of content generates revenue from three different streams simultaneously.

Step 5: SEO for Soundscapes

Your title and metadata are your storefront. Use high-intent keywords like “ADHD Focus,” “Deep Work,” “Tinnitus Masking,” and “Study Aid.” When you upload to YouTube, use a static, high-quality image or a very simple cinemagraph created in Canva. The goal is to make the video as low-bandwidth as possible while maximizing the audio quality. People aren’t watching; they’re listening.

4 Fatal Mistakes New Sound Creators Make

  • Ignoring Commercial Rights: Always ensure the AI tool you use grants you full commercial ownership of the output. Read the fine print!
  • Low Bitrate Audio: Audiophiles and focus-seekers can hear compression. Always export in WAV or 320kbps MP3 format.
  • Generic Visuals: If your YouTube thumbnail looks like a 2005 screensaver, nobody will click. Use modern, minimalist aesthetics.
  • Inconsistent Posting: The algorithms for both YouTube and Spotify reward regular contributions. Aim for at least two new “environments” per week.
